All Hail the Man-Child King
Photo by Sunyu on Unsplash

All hail, the child-man!

who deceives himself with whatever he can

who takes what he wants, from his problems he ran

then destruction was brought throughout all of his land

how sad to behold what this man-child could be

for his mind did not match what we thought we could see

for outside he seemed to look like a man

but inside, maturity his mind seemed to ban

confronted with this

he made him a list

and inside his heart

his issues started to dart

all things backward, wayward, and wrong

started to sing a new healing song

he started to grow inside and out

and in his spirit there seemed to not be anymore doubt

now this man has peace with the child

no more in conflict, they no longer run wild

all hail the Man-Child king

who now has peace with himself

O' how sweet freedom can ring!

-Sean Rivera
